Transaction 2458eb9097323161d73d91dfd0181d1c500a7ee1b5d2504127cf6381f295665d
1 Input
2 Outputs
- 2458eb9097323161d73d91dfd0181d1c500a7ee1b5d2504127cf6381f295665d:0
- 2458eb9097323161d73d91dfd0181d1c500a7ee1b5d2504127cf6381f295665d:1
value 61968
address 1JNoTcy24zoTJrYpDS5x8hE1Z1ZktT3EPX
value 857482
address 12H59Jf59FCmaXXRCmHHHoeo7UVFraFd2S